On the ground in Nepal: Empty streets under tight army watch

On the ground in Nepal: Empty streets under tight army watch

Posted on September 10, 2025 By admin


Reporting from Lazimpat Road, usually one of Kathmandu’s busiest stretches, The Hindu’s Health Editor Ramya Kannan describes a city transformed. On Tuesday night, protesters set fire to garbage heaps and staged “victory marches,” but by Wednesday afternoon, army pickets and checkpoints had replaced the crowds.
